Contrast: Highlighting Differences for Harmony
While complement seeks synergy through similarity, contrast achieves balance through opposition. This principle leverages opposing characteristics to prevent palate fatigue, cut through richness, or highlight specific nuances in either the beer or the food. The classic example involves using the assertive bitterness of a West Coast IPA to cut through the unctuous fat of a greasy burger, preventing the dish from becoming cloying and refreshing the palate for the next bite.
Acidity is another powerful contrasting agent. A tart Berliner Weisse or a sour Lambic can provide a vibrant counterpoint to rich, fatty fish or creamy sauces, brightening the dish and adding a welcome zest. The acidity acts as a palate cleanser, much like lemon on seafood, preventing the heavier elements from dominating and allowing other flavors to emerge.
Sweetness and spice also offer opportunities for contrast. A malty, slightly sweet Doppelbock can temper the heat of a spicy curry, providing a soothing counterpoint that allows the intricate spice blend to shine without overwhelming the palate. Conversely, a highly attenuated, dry beer can contrast with a sweet dessert, preventing it from becoming overly saccharine and introducing a balancing dryness.
Cut: Cleansing the Palate
The 'cut' principle focuses specifically on the beer's ability to cleanse and refresh the palate, preparing it for the next bite. This is primarily achieved through three mechanisms: carbonation, acidity, and bitterness. High carbonation acts as a physical scrub, lifting residual fats and flavors from the tongue, much like a sparkling wine. This makes effervescent beers, such as crisp lagers or Belgian Tripels, exceptional partners for fried foods or rich, heavy dishes.
Acidity in beer, whether from lactic acid in a Gose or acetic acid in a Flanders Red Ale, provides a chemical palate cleanser. It can cut through richness and reset the taste buds, making subsequent bites as vibrant as the first. This is particularly effective with dishes that have a high fat content or are intensely flavored, preventing the palate from becoming saturated.
Finally, hop bitterness, especially in styles like India Pale Ales, can also contribute to palate cleansing. While often used for contrast with rich foods, its inherent astringency and drying effect can strip away lingering flavors, preparing the palate for the next mouthful. The interplay of these elements ensures that each bite of food and sip of beer maintains its distinct character and impact.
The Role of Beer's Core Components in Pairing
A nuanced understanding of beer's core components—malt, hops, yeast, and water—is paramount for effective pairing. Malt provides the backbone of a beer, contributing sweetness, body, color, and a spectrum of flavors from bready and biscuity to caramel, chocolate, and roasted notes. These elements can be leveraged for both complement (e.g., roasted malt with grilled meats) and contrast (e.g., residual sweetness balancing spice).
Hops contribute bitterness, aroma, and flavor, ranging from earthy and floral to citrusy and resinous. Bitterness is a primary tool for cutting through richness and fat, while hop aromatics can complement or contrast with herbaceous, spicy, or fruity elements in food. The specific hop varietal and its application (bittering vs. aroma) significantly influence its pairing potential.
Yeast is the unsung hero, responsible for fermentation and the production of a vast array of esters (fruity notes like banana or apple) and phenols (spicy notes like clove or pepper). These yeast-derived flavors are crucial for complementing fruit-based dishes, spicy cuisine, or specific cheese types. Water chemistry, while often overlooked, affects mouthfeel and perceived bitterness, subtly influencing how a beer interacts with food components, particularly minerals and salts.
Considering Intensity and Weight
Beyond the 'complement, contrast, cut' framework, successful pairing hinges on matching the intensity and weight of the beer to the food. Intensity refers to the boldness and assertiveness of flavors and aromas. A delicate Pilsner, with its subtle malt and hop character, would be overwhelmed by a heavily spiced curry. Conversely, an Imperial Stout would overshadow a light salad, rendering the food's nuances imperceptible. The goal is a balanced interplay where neither component dominates, but rather enhances the other.
Weight, or body, relates to the perceived richness and viscosity of both the beer and the food. A light-bodied lager pairs harmoniously with lighter fare like grilled chicken or delicate seafood, where its crispness and lower alcohol content do not overpower. A full-bodied Imperial Stout, with its substantial mouthfeel and higher alcohol, is better suited for robust dishes such as braised short ribs or rich desserts, where it can stand up to and complement the food's heft.
Misalignment in intensity or weight can lead to a 'flavor clash' or one component being 'washed out' by the other. A careful assessment of both the beer's and the food's inherent power and structural density is crucial for achieving a harmonious and mutually enhancing pairing.
Practical Application: A Framework for Pairing
To apply these principles systematically, begin by analyzing the dominant characteristics of the food. Identify its primary flavors (sweet, sour, salty, bitter, umami), its textural profile (creamy, crispy, fatty, lean), and any prominent aromatic compounds (spicy, herbaceous, fruity, roasted). This deconstruction provides a roadmap for selecting an appropriate beer. For instance, a dish high in fat immediately suggests a beer with high carbonation, acidity, or bitterness for cutting.
Next, consider the beer's profile. Evaluate its malt character (sweetness, roast), hop character (bitterness, aroma), yeast character (esters, phenols), and overall body and carbonation. With both profiles in mind, strategically choose whether to complement (e.g., matching roasted notes), contrast (e.g., bitter hops against fat), or cut (e.g., carbonation cleansing the palate). Often, a successful pairing will employ a combination of these strategies, with one taking precedence.
Experimentation is key, but this structural framework provides a logical starting point. Rather than guessing, you can predict how a beer's inherent properties will interact with a dish, leading to more consistent and satisfying pairings.
